Itinerary
Everest Base Camp(12 days)
Day 1st ; Drive to Airport ,Fly to Lukla & Hike to Phakding. Day 2nd; Hike to Namche bazzar. Day 3rd; Rest day & explore Namche bazzar. Day 4th ;Hike to Tengbouche. Day 5th ;Hike to dengbouche. Day 6th ;Rest Day & explore chukkung . Day 7th ;Hike to loubche. Day 8th ;Hike to Gorekshep -EBC Gorekshep. Day 9th ;Hike to Kalapatther-Gorekshep-Pireche. Day 10th ;Hike to Namche. Day 11th ;Hike to Lukla . Day 12th ;Fly to Kathmandu.
